Noroña vs. ‘Alito’, make it happen, Poncho de Nigris: What fights do fans want for Ring Royale 2?

Fans are eagerly requesting exciting matchups for the second edition of Ring Royale after its successful first event hosted by Poncho de Nigris.

Ring Royale, an event hosted by Poncho de Nigris, was a tremendous success, breaking YouTube audience records and sparking conversations online. Fans are already clamoring for more epic matchups for the upcoming second edition, although no definitive dates have been announced yet. The first event featured a dramatic encounter between Alfredo Adame and Carlos Trejo, whose long-standing rivalry culminated in a surprising reconciliation, earning much attention and suggesting potential for similarly engaging bouts in the future.

The concept of influencer boxing events has seen a significant rise in popularity, with Ring Royale emerging as a promising platform for such spectacles in Mexico. Inspired by events like La Velada del Año organized by Ibai Llanos, the format of mixing entertainment with amateur boxing appears to resonate well with audiences, especially among younger demographics. The first Ring Royale's success seems to have laid a solid foundation for expanding the event and attracting more viewers.

Looking ahead to the second edition, fans are proposing various matchups that are not only entertaining but also have the potential to draw in millions of viewers. With the groundwork having been established, the anticipation for more thrilling and viral moments in the realm of influencer boxing is palpable, suggesting that Poncho de Nigris's next venture could be just as impactful as the first.
